Legal Framework in Bangladesh
The legal framework governing immigration in Bangladesh is primarily based on the Immigration Act of 1982, which outlines the policies, procedures, and penalties associated with immigration. The Act is complemented by various rules and regulations that govern specific aspects such as visa classifications, residency permits, and the rights and responsibilities of immigrants.
Understanding the legal framework is crucial for anyone engaging with the Bangladesh immigration office locations. This framework not only dictates how applications are processed but also establishes the rights and obligations of applicants. The Ministry of Home Affairs, along with the Department of Immigration and Passports (DIP), oversees the enforcement of these laws, ensuring a standardized approach to immigration across the nation.
Key Provisions and Requirements
To successfully navigate the immigration process in Bangladesh, it is essential to be aware of key provisions and requirements that pertain to different visa categories. Below is a table summarizing the most common visa types and their requirements:
| Visa Type | Purpose | Key Requirements |
|---|---|---|
| Tourist Visa | Short-term visits for tourism | Passport, application form, and proof of accommodation |
| Work Visa | Employment in Bangladesh | Job offer letter, work permit, and educational certificates |
| Student Visa | Educational purposes | Acceptance letter from an educational institution and proof of funds |
| Business Visa | Business-related activities | Invitation letter from a Bangladeshi company and proof of financial stability |
Each visa category has its own specific requirements that must be met when applying through the Bangladesh immigration office locations. Failure to meet these requirements can lead to delays or denials in the application process.
Step-by-Step Process / Practical Guide
Understanding the step-by-step process involved in applying for a visa or residency permit is essential for a successful immigration experience. Here is a concise guide to help you navigate the process:
- Determine Visa Type: Identify the appropriate visa category based on your purpose of travel.
- Gather Required Documents: Collect all necessary documents as per the requirements outlined in the previous section.
- Complete Application Form: Fill out the relevant application form accurately.
- Submit Application: Visit the nearest Bangladesh immigration office location to submit your application and pay any applicable fees.
- Attend Interview (if required): Some visa categories may require an interview; ensure you are prepared.
- Receive Decision: Wait for the immigration office to process your application and communicate their decision.
This step-by-step guide provides a clear pathway for navigating the immigration process, ensuring compliance with legal requirements and maximization of your chances for approval.
